Background
A drilling machine is a set of complex machine and consists of a machine, a machine set and a mechanism. The drilling machine is a mechanical device which drives a drilling tool to drill underground to obtain real geological data in exploration or mineral resource (including solid ore, liquid ore, gas ore and the like) development.
Present rig does not have the special leather hose that prevents to rig into water and twines hank mobile jib device, mainly lean on rig mobile jib into tap pulley bearing and make into water tap and keep relative static when the mobile jib is high-speed rotatory, but use, in the work progress, pulley bearing has inevitable into mud, advance sand, or the not enough condition of lubrication, lead to into water tap and can not keep relative static and rotatory along with the main drilling rod, and then make into water the leather hose and twine hank mobile jib, this is very dangerous, then the disconnected leather hose of hank lightly, then the leather hose is struggled away and is threw along with the main drilling rod is flown soon heavily, injure personnel on every side.

With reference to fig. 2 and fig. 5, on the basis of the first embodiment, further obtaining that the fixing mechanism 5 includes a stabilizing clamp 501, the stabilizing clamp 501 is fixedly connected to one end of the connecting rod 404 far away from the third sleeve 403, the front and back of the stabilizing clamp 501 are both fixedly connected with a connecting plate 502, a bolt 503 is arranged inside the connecting plate 502, and the outer wall of the left end of the bolt 503 is in threaded connection with a nut 504, so as to clamp the water inlet faucet.
Furthermore, a through hole matched with the bolt 503 is formed in the connecting plate 502, and the bolt 503 penetrates through the connecting plate 502 through the formed through hole, so that the bolt 503 can play a role in fixing under the mutual matching of the nuts 504.
In the actual operation process, when the device is used, firstly, the nut 504 is screwed off from the bolt 503, then the bolt 503 is drawn out from the inside of the connecting plate 502, so that the inner sides of the two stabilizing clamps 501 and the outer wall of the water inlet tap play a role in clamping, then the bolt 503 penetrates through the connecting plate 502, then the nut 504 is screwed on the outer wall of the bolt 503, the two stabilizing clamps 501 are fastened through the connecting plate 502, the inner sides of the stabilizing clamps 501 are tightly attached to the outer wall of the water inlet tap, and therefore the water inlet tap can not rotate along with the main drill rod.
After the water inlet faucet is fixed, at this time, the pull ring 410 can be pulled, so that the first sleeve 401 pulls the first clamping block 411 through the pull rod 408 to move, then the water inlet leather hose is placed on the inner side of the second clamping block 412, the pull ring 410 is loosened, the inner side of the first clamping block 411 can be pushed to be tightly attached to the inner side of the water inlet leather hose under the elastic action of the spring 409, the water inlet leather hose is stored and fixed, when the water inlet faucet is lifted, the connecting rod 404 can be driven to ascend, so that the connecting sleeve 3 can be driven to slide on the outer wall of the drill upright column 2, and the drill upright column 2 is inclined, so that the connecting sleeve 3 can be lifted through the first sleeve 401, the second sleeve 402, the third sleeve 403 and the connecting rod 404, and the distance between the connecting sleeve 3 and the stabilizing clamp 501 is continuously reduced, and the lifting can be realized.
